Try class
An alias for Call effect. It makes try/catch/finally code blocks more readable.
It is useful to catch errors during effect resolve and instruct finally blocks. It is not possible to catch effect resolve errors by standart try/catch blocks. Try effect must be used to handle those errors and finally code blocks.
Example
In the following example, there is a simple checkout saga function.
It tries to checkout the cart. If fails it dispatches a CheckoutFailure
action.
import 'package:redux_saga/redux_saga.dart';
import 'Api.dart';
//...
checkout() sync* {
yield Try(() sync* {
var cart = Result<Cart>();
yield Select(selector: getCart, result: cart);
yield Call(buyProductsAPI, args: [cart.value]);
yield Put(CheckoutSuccess(cart.value));
}, Catch: (e, s) sync* {
yield Put(CheckoutFailure(error));
});
}
